Freigeben über


Hinzufügen von globalen Listen zu einer Prozessvorlage

Sie können der Prozessvorlage globale Listen hinzufügen, um die Definition einer Gruppe von Werten zu optimieren, die gemeinsam mit mehreren Arbeitsaufgabentypen verwendet werden. Eine globale Liste definiert eine Liste von Werten, die Sie für die Steuerung des Werts oder der Werte verwenden können, für die Benutzer ein Feld in einer Arbeitsaufgabe festlegen können. Eine globale Liste definiert die verfügbaren Einträge aus einem Dropdownmenü oder einer Auswahlliste in einem Arbeitsaufgabenformular oder einer Arbeitsaufgabenabfrage. Globale Listen werden verwendet, um den Inhalt von Auswahllisten, die für viele Arbeitsaufgabentypen genutzt werden, schnell aktualisieren zu können.

Sie geben die Datei an, die die globalen Listen definiert, die innerhalb des taskxml-Elements des Arbeitsaufgabenverfolgungs-Plug-Ins hochgeladen werden sollen.

Tipp

Die Prozessvorlagen für Microsoft Solutions Framework (MSF) v5.0 geben keine globalen Listen an.

In diesem Thema

  • Definieren von globalen Listen

  • Angeben einer hochzuladenden globalen Listendefinitionsdatei

  • GLOBALLIST-Elementverweis

Nachdem ein Teamprojekt anhand der Prozessvorlage erstellt wurde, können Sie globale Listen für eine Teamprojektsammlung importieren und exportieren, indem Sie das Befehlszeilentool witadmin verwenden. Weitere Informationen finden Sie unter Verwalten von globalen Listen für Arbeitsaufgabentypen [witadmin].

Definieren von globalen Listen

Die Definition von globalen Listen muss in einer eigenen Datei angegeben werden. Verwenden Sie dazu das übergeordnete Element GLOBALLISTS (Definition), und achten Sie darauf, dass der Schemadefinition gemäß ihrer Festlegung in der Datei "globalists-01.xsd" entsprochen wird. Die Schemadateien für die Verfolgung von Arbeitsaufgaben stehen auf der folgenden Seite der Microsoft-Website zum Download bereit: Prozessvorlagen- und Arbeitsaufgabenschemas für Visual Studio Team Foundation.

Im folgenden Beispiel wird ein Beispiel einer Definitionsdatei für eine globale Listendatei gezeigt, die eine globale Liste mit dem Namen "Aufgabentyp" enthält.

<?xml version="1.0" encoding="utf-8"?>
<GLOBALLISTS>
    <GLOBALLIST name="Task Type">
        <LISTITEM value="Writing" />
        <LISTITEM value="Research" />
        <LISTITEM value="Review" />
        <LISTITEM value="Editing" />
        <LISTITEM value="Miscellaneous" />
    </GLOBALLIST>
</GLOBALLISTS>

Weitere Informationen finden Sie unter Definieren von globalen Listen.

Zurück nach oben

Angeben einer Definitionsdatei für eine hochzuladende globale Liste

Zum Hochladen von globalen Listendefinitionen geben Sie das GLOBALLISTS-Element innerhalb des taskxml-Elements an. Das filename-Attribut entspricht dem relativen Pfad der Definitionsdatei für globale Listen.

Im folgenden Beispiel wird gezeigt, wie eine Aufgabe angegeben wird, mit der eine Datei hochgeladen wird, die globale Listen enthält.

<task id="GlobalLists" name="Global lists definition" plugin="Microsoft.ProjectCreationWizard.WorkItemTracking" completionMessage="Global lists created">
   <taskXml>
      <GLOBALLISTS fileName="WorkItem Tracking\GlobalLists.xml" />
   </taskXml>
</task>

Zurück nach oben

GLOBALLISTS-Elementverweis

In der folgenden Tabelle wird das GLOBALLISTS-Element beschrieben, mit dem Sie eine Definitionsdatei für eine globale Liste hochladen können. Dieses Element wird innerhalb eines taskXml-Containerelements in der Arbeitsaufgabenverfolgungs-Plug-In-Datei angegeben.

Tipp

Eine hochzuladende Definitionsdatei wird mit dem GLOBALLISTS (Arbeitsaufgabenverfolgungs)-Element angegeben. Globale Listen werden mit dem GLOBALLISTS (Definition)-Element definiert. Weitere Informationen finden Sie unter Definieren von globalen Listen.

Element

Syntax

Beschreibung

GLOBALLISTS

<GLOBALLISTS fileName="GlobalListFilePathName" />

Optionales untergeordnetes Element des Arbeitsaufgabenverfolgungs-Plug-Ins.

Gibt den Pfad und den Namen der Datei an, die die Definitionen für globale Listen enthält, die bei der Verarbeitung der Arbeitsaufgabenverfolgungs-Plug-In-Aufgabe hochgeladen werden müssen.

Zurück nach oben

Siehe auch

Referenz

Verwalten von globalen Listen für Arbeitsaufgabentypen [witadmin]

Konzepte

Definieren von globalen Listen

Weitere Ressourcen

Definieren und Anpassen von Objekten zum Nachverfolgen von Arbeitsaufgaben mit dem Plug-In für die Arbeitsaufgabenverfolgung